-
-
-
-
Tailored Fit Blue Moroccan Print Cotton Formal Shirt with Floral Contrast
Was £39.99 As low as £19.99 -
Blue Moroccan Print Cotton Formal Shirt with Floral Contrast
Was £44.99 As low as £24.99 -
Tailored Fit Blue Flower Print Long Sleeve Formal Shirt
Was £39.99 As low as £24.99